This is a feature Request

I would like to have a property in the v-form to disable all the children. Right now if a developer has to disable all the fields in a form , he has to add disabled prop to all children which becomes cumbersome and difficult to maintain and prone to errors , for ex: if developer misses to add the property to one of the elements
